FAQs


What is included in the price of my trip?

  1. All accommodation – based on a twin-share basis
  2. Most ground transport as listed in itinerary
  3. Meals
  4. Full time service of group leader

What is NOT included in the price of my trip?

  1. International or internal flights unless specified
  2. Visa and passport fees
  3. Departure taxes, excess baggage fees, or airport transfers unless specified
  4. Insurance of any kind
  5. Meals and drinks not specified
  6. Optional activities
  7. Items of personal nature, laundry, postage

Travel Documents
All participants will be provided with a detailed list of required travel documents relating to the nature and destination of each Venture Expeditions trip. All trips not based in the U.S.A will require a valid Passport that must be valid 6 months past your tour return date. In addition, all other required documentation such as: all visas, permits and certificates including vaccination certificates, and insurance policies, will be clearly stated in the prep packet sent to all participants upon acceptance to each specific trip. It is the participants responsibility to arrange visas and passports unless otherwise indicated.

Itineraries
The nature of our trips requires a considerable amount of flexibility. It should be understood that the route, schedules, itineraries, amenities and mode of transport may be subject to alteration without prior notice due to local circumstances or events, which may include sickness or mechanical breakdown, flight cancellations, strikes, events emanating from political disputes, entry or border difficulties, climate and other unpredictable or unforeseen circumstance. In the event of a change to the itinerary, all participants will be notified as soon as possible. Some trips may have a very limited itinerary.

Local Conditions
Each participant acknowledges that he/she will be visiting places where the political, cultural and geographical attributes present certain risks, dangers and physical challenges greater than those present in our daily lives. All participants are solely responsible for acquainting themselves with the customs, weather conditions, physical challenges and laws in effect at each stop along the itinerary, and is encourages to locate or make contact prior to embarkation with his/her local embassy or consulate in each destination.
